Microsoft Redefines Xbox Strategy With Focus on Cross-Platform Gaming
CEO Satya Nadella emphasizes Xbox's pivot to cloud gaming and multiplatform access, raising questions about the future of its hardware and exclusivity.
- Microsoft's new 'This is an Xbox' campaign highlights its strategy to make Xbox games accessible across devices, including smart TVs, PCs, phones, and handhelds, through cloud gaming.
- Xbox-exclusive titles are increasingly launching on rival platforms like PlayStation and Nintendo Switch, signaling a shift away from traditional exclusivity.
- While Xbox hardware sales have declined, CEO Satya Nadella reaffirmed Microsoft's commitment to future console innovations, including potential handheld devices.
- The $75.4 billion Activision Blizzard acquisition has integrated major franchises into Xbox Game Pass, contributing to record-breaking $21.5 billion in gaming revenue for FY24.
- Some long-time Xbox fans express concerns over the brand's evolving identity, as Microsoft focuses on subscription growth and cross-platform accessibility.
